Brigham Young University Centennial Carillon Tower
The BYU Centennial Carillon is a bell tower containing a carillon on the campus of Brigham Young University in Provo, Utah, United States.Photo: An Errant Knight, CC BY-SA 4.0.

LaVell Edwards Stadium
Stadium
Photo: Bobak, CC BY-SA 2.5.
LaVell Edwards Stadium is an outdoor athletic stadium in the Western United States, on the campus of Brigham Young University in Provo, Utah. Primarily used for college football, it is the home field of the BYU Cougars, a member of the Big 12 Conference in the Football Bowl Subdivision.
